The latest installment of the lab's story on DA dynamics is now published in Life. Work from @mohebial and Val Collins, in which we demonstrate how cholinergic interneurons in accumbens promote DA release and enable motivated approach.
Tweet card summary image
elifesciences.org
In awake behaving rats, cholinergic interneurons in the nucleus accumbens drive dopamine release via nicotinic receptors, boosting motivation to work.

Preprint of a study spearheaded by Bon-Mi Gu. Here we investigated the population dynamics of rat GPe neurons during preparation-to-stop, stopping, and going. Check the full-text if you're interested!.
Tweet card summary image
biorxiv.org
Flexible behavior requires restraint or cancellation of actions that are no longer appropriate. This behavioral inhibition critically relies on frontal cortex - basal ganglia circuits. A central node...
